2007-01606 Jose Navarro, appellant, v Richard W. Gell, et al., respondents. (Index No. 100837-03)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ant to stay all proceedings in the above-entitled action, including the trial on the issue of damages, pending hearing and determination of an appeal from a judgment of the Supreme Court, Suffolk County, entered January 25, 2007.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motion is denied.
